The Organisation of African Trade Union Unity (OATUU) joins the African Union in observing the 2026 AU Theme, “Assuring Sustainable Water Availability and Safe Sanitation Systems to Achieve the Goals of Agenda 2063.” This theme highlights the urgent need for sustainable water and sanitation services as central to Africa’s socio-economic transformation and the successful realization of Agenda 2063.
Access to safe water and sanitation remains a development imperative. Across Africa, many communities still lack reliable water and sanitation services, leaving them vulnerable to health risks and environmental challenges. Climate change exacerbates these pressures, causing droughts, floods, and contamination that threaten both people and ecosystems.
OATUU underscores the need for strong governance, regulatory systems, and inclusive policies to ensure every African’s right to water and sanitation. We commend the AU’s Africa Water Vision 2063 and urge all stakeholders to take proactive steps to secure safe water, sustainable sanitation, and equitable services for all.
OATUU and its affiliates remain committed to supporting and actively participating in initiatives that advance water security, safeguard public health, and accelerate Africa’s progress toward Agenda 2063.
